Heating replacement in Arlington follows the city’s stark neighborhood-era divide. South Arlington and Interlochen (1970s-80s) homes are where I replace the most furnaces — 20-30 year old gas units with cracked heat exchangers, condemned inducer motors, or R-22 companion systems where the furnace and AC both need to go at the same time. For those slab-on-grade ranch homes with attic-mounted air handlers, I typically recommend a matched system (furnace + AC in the same tier) because pairing a new variable-speed blower with an aging, mismatched condenser — or vice versa — throws away most of the efficiency and comfort gains you’re paying for. Dalworthington Gardens follows the same pattern: 1960s-90s housing stock, original or once-replaced furnaces, and duct systems that often need attention alongside the equipment swap.
North Arlington and Viridian homeowners asking about heating replacement are usually evaluating heat pumps rather than gas furnaces — and in Arlington’s climate (200+ cooling days, only 20-30 freeze nights, and warm shoulder seasons), a modern variable-speed heat pump genuinely outperforms a furnace-only setup for total annual comfort and efficiency. You get heating and cooling from one system, efficiency down to about 15°F ambient (electric heat strips handle anything below that), and you eliminate annual gas furnace safety inspections because there’s no combustion in the system. Heat pumps add approximately $2,000 over the equivalent tier but may qualify for federal energy tax credits and Oncor rebates — check with your tax professional on current eligibility.
